COR & Compression

COR (Coefficient of Restitution) and Compression are the two most important performance measurements for any baseball. Together they determine how "live" the ball feels, how fast it comes off the bat, and how firm or soft it plays.

What is COR?

COR measures rebound efficiency — how much energy is returned after impact. Tested by firing the ball at a controlled speed against a hard surface and measuring the rebound speed.

  • Higher COR = more exit velocity, more liveliness, greater distance potential
  • Influenced by core design, rubber composition, winding tension, and construction quality
  • Consistent COR across a batch = predictable, reliable performance ball to ball

What is Compression?

Compression measures firmness — how much the ball deforms when pressure is applied. Tested by applying a controlled force and measuring the degree of deformation.

  • Higher compression = feels firmer, holds shape better, used at higher levels of play
  • Lower compression = softer feel, reduces impact force, common in youth and entry-level balls
  • Affected by core materials, winding tightness, yarn composition, and construction density



Why They Matter Together

COR and Compression work in combination. Together they influence:

  • Exit velocity — how fast the ball leaves the bat
  • Feel off the bat — the sensation of contact for hitters
  • Durability — how well the ball holds its performance over time
  • Pitch response — how the ball behaves when thrown and caught
  • Overall game performance and consistency

Small changes in core materials, windings, stitching, and leather can significantly impact both measurements — which is why manufacturing consistency matters as much as material quality.
